Overview

Appui aux projets d’investissement favorisant la résilience des scieries de bois d’œuvre résineux offers interest-free loans to Quebec for-profit and social economy enterprises for investment projects of at least $10M. Eligible projects include production diversification, development of new value-added products, and productivity improvements such as automation, artificial intelligence, and digital transformation.

Activities funded

  • Diversification of production
  • Development of new value-added products
  • Productivity improvement, including automation, artificial intelligence, and digital transformation

Documents Needed

  • Three years of financial statements and/or forecast financial statements, as needed
  • Business plan detailing the planned investment, target market, estimated costs, financial structure, schedule, and expected contribution to resilience and financial viability
  • Proof of compliance with francization requirements, if applicable
  • Declaration of compliance with the Equal Access to Employment Program, if applicable
  • Any other document required by the ministère de l’Économie, de l’Innovation et de l’Énergie (MEIE) or the Ministère des Ressources naturelles et des Forêts (MRNF)

Eligibility

Who is eligible?

  • For-profit companies registered in Quebec
  • Social economy enterprises within the meaning of the Act respecting social economy (CQLR, chapter E 1.1.1) registered in Quebec
  • Companies linked to, or part of, a corporate group operating a softwood lumber sawmill in Quebec
  • Companies operating a softwood lumber sawmill in Quebec

Eligible expenses

  • Acquisition, construction or expansion of buildings
  • Purchase and implementation of equipment or software
  • Expenses related to technological transformation, including cloud computing, business intelligence, and artificial intelligence
  • Working capital related to the project, up to 20%

Processing and Agreement

  • Applications are assessed for admissibility, analysis, and decision by Investissement Québec teams.
  • If the request is deemed admissible, the applicant must provide the requested documents.

Additional information

  • The program is administered by Investissement Québec as a mandatary of the Government of Quebec.
  • The MEIE and Investissement Québec may suspend the filing and analysis of applications without notice to protect available budget envelope amounts.
  • Applicants are invited to consult the program's normative framework for more information.

Who is eligible for the ESSOR - Component 5 program?

To be eligible for the ESSOR - Component 5 program, you must: Be a for-profit company or a social economy enterprise registered in Quebec. Have an establishment and carry on business in Quebec for at least 2 years. Be linked to, or part of, a corporate group operating a Quebec softwood lumber sawmill, with a project integrated into at least one strategic sawmill.
